>The RC has not excommunicated Hitler because Hitler was not an RC. Have
>to be an RC to be excommunicated.

Constantine's Sword, p44:  "We knew enough to contrast Pius XII's silence in 
relation to Nazism with his forthright condemnations of Communism, including 
his 1949 excommunication, "at a stroke," of Communist Party members 
everywhere in the world.18  [18. Kung, Hans, Judaism: Between Yesterday and 
Tomorrow, p256.]  Yet not even Hitler was ever excommunicated, and it shamed 
us to realize only now that the German dictator died still on the rolls of 
the Roman Catholic Church into which he had been baptized as an infant.19  
[19. One way to account for Hitler's not having been excommunicated is that 
the Church takes such drastic action to combat "wrong thinking" more than 
"wrong acting." The theologian Bernard J. Lee,S.M., comments, "To some 
extent, it is a function of the western deep story that Arius, Martin Luther, 
George Tyrrell, and Leonard Feeney were excommunicated, and Hitler was not." 
But such a distinction assumes that Hitler's actions were not rooted in 
"wrong thinking," and the Church saw no such dichotomy when it came to 
communism. Lee, Jesus and the metaphors of God, p89.]
